Instructions: Sift the dry ingredients into a medium sized bowl. In another bowl beat eggs; add milk and beat together. Add milk and egg mixture to the flour mixture and mix well. Lastly add 1/2 stick of melted butter. Let stand for about 10 minutes. Heat griddle. When hot, brush with a little butter. Pour 1/8 to 1/4 cup of batter on griddle. When the pancake is all bubbly, turn and brown on the other side. Keep your griddle very hot, but not on the highest setting. No need to add any more butter to griddle for additional pancakes. Just cook the pancakes and enjoy. If your griddle is large, you can do several pancakes at a time. Fresh berries, chocolate chips, chopped mangos, or whathaveyou, makes the pancakes interesting and different. Serve with pure maple syrup or spread on a little butter on each pancake and shake powdered sugar on top. Any way you fix these, theyre winners! NOTE These are very good with Marys Apple Pie Syrup.
